Summary

Buckeye Central High School is a public high school located in New Washington, Ohio, serving grades 9-12 with a total enrollment of 186 students. The school is part of the Buckeye Central Local District, which is ranked 183 out of 828 districts in Ohio and has a 4-star rating from SchoolDigger.

Buckeye Central High School has consistently performed well on state assessments, with high proficiency rates across various subjects, including American Government, American History, Biology, English II, Geometry, and Algebra I, exceeding the state averages in these areas. The school has also maintained an excellent 98% four-year graduation rate, significantly higher than the state average. While the school's chronic absenteeism rate has fluctuated over the years, it has generally been lower than the state average.

In comparison to nearby schools, Galion High School, located 14.71 miles away, has lower proficiency rates and a lower graduation rate compared to Buckeye Central. Additionally, Buckeye Central High School has shown exceptional performance in serving its gifted and talented student population, ranking 8th out of 272 Ohio high schools for this subgroup. However, the school's ranking for special education and disabled students is lower compared to other subgroups, suggesting an area for potential improvement.
